  • Scott Bessent said he will travel Monday to Japan and South Korea, then meet Chinese Vice Premier He Lifeng in Seoul on Wednesday before heading to Beijing for the Trump-Xi summit.
  • Thursday-Friday talks between Donald Trump and Xi Jinping in Beijing are the backdrop for the trip, with Bessent framing the meetings as part of an "America First" economic agenda and trade discussions.
  • Seoul is expected to use Bessent's brief stop to discuss foreign exchange and broader financial issues, though local media said no meetings with Finance Minister Koo Yun-cheol had been finalized because of scheduling constraints.
  • South Korea's foreign ministry said it is coordinating closely with both Washington and Beijing on arrangements, taking into account Bessent's single-day stay and China's separate announcement that He will visit South Korea this week.

Seoul as Strategic Ground: U.S.-China Economic Security Talks and the 2026 Trump-Xi Summit

Overview

U.S.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ent will visit Seoul on May 13, 2026, as a key step before the summit between President Trump and President Xi Jinping. The main goal of Bessent’s trip is to hold trade talks with China’s Vice Premier He Lifeng, reflecting the Trump administration’s focus on its 'America First Economic Agenda' and the belief that economic security is national security. Seoul was chosen as a neutral venue for these sensitive U.S.-China discussions, highlighting its strategic role. Vice Premier He Lifeng’s participation shows how important these talks are for Beijing.
